An Overview of the Experience

Rock the Mic Karaoke Party Bus - An Overview of the Experience

This tour isn’t your typical sightseeing jaunt; it’s a mobile karaoke party that combines the best parts of a club night with the sights of the Vegas Strip. The two-hour experience starts with pickup on the Strip, where your group gets comfortable onboard what feels like a private concert venue on wheels.

The Itinerary: What You’ll See and Do

The first stop is the famous Las Vegas Strip itself. Whether you choose to hop off for photos or just cruise by, this iconic stretch is always worth a quick glance. The bus then moves to the Fountains of Bellagio, where you can admire the synchronized water show, or simply enjoy the view from inside the bus if you prefer not to stop. Lastly, the Sphere rounds out the sightseeing, adding a modern touch—this is a flexible part of the tour, so you can customize your experience.

Throughout the cruise, you’ll have the freedom to make as many stops as you’d like—whether for photos, quick sightseeing, or just to soak in the atmosphere. This flexibility allows your group to tailor the experience for maximum fun and convenience.

The Karaoke Setup: A Rolling Concert

The star of this experience is undoubtedly the sound system—club-level quality that makes everyone feel like a star. Lyrics are displayed on a TV, so even the shyest singers can follow along. Whether you’re belting out a guilty pleasure or showing off your vocal chops, the system ensures your performance sounds as good as it feels.

With a song selection of over 33,000 tracks, the options are practically endless. It’s perfect for all ages, though note that you must be 21+ to drink onboard. The hosts keep the party lively, and the whole bus becomes an energetic, supportive crowd.

Practical Details and Comfort

The tour is offered in the daytime, with hours from 10 AM to 11 PM, making it adaptable for different schedules. The pickup is near public transportation, which is convenient for travelers staying in or near the Strip. Most travelers can participate—regardless of singing skill—since the focus is on fun, not perfection.

The ticket costs $599 per group and covers up to 15 people, making it fairly affordable when you consider the private experience and entertainment value. Bottled water is included, and you’re welcome to bring your own drinks—just remember, it’s for ages 21 and over.

FAQs

Rock the Mic Karaoke Party Bus - FAQs

Is the tour private for my group? Yes, only your group participates, making it a private experience.

How long does the tour last? About two hours, including cruising and singing.

Can I stop for photos? Absolutely. You can choose to stop for pictures or just cruise by the sights.

What sights are included? The tour stops at The Las Vegas Strip, Fountains of Bellagio, and the Sphere, with flexibility for stops.

Is alcohol allowed onboard? You can bring your own drinks, as long as you’re 21 or older. Ice and plastic cups are provided.

Is the experience suitable for all ages? It’s primarily for adults 21+, especially if they plan to drink during the tour.

What music options do I have? Over 33,000 songs across all genres, from throwbacks to current hits.

Are there any hidden costs? Gratuity is not included, so plan accordingly.

When can I book this tour? The experience is available from January 2026 through February 2027, Monday through Thursday, from 10 AM to 11 PM.

What if the weather is poor? The tour requires good weather; if canceled due to rain or storms, you’ll be offered a refund or alternative date.
